How far will the boat travel before she needs charging up again?
20 nautical miles, i.e. from Stockholm to Sandhamn. Although we expect to be able to present versions with even longer range when the time comes for the launch.
How fast does an electrically powered boat go?
Top speed 27 knots, cruising speed 22 knots (this version).
What about maintenance?
There is less maintenance involved than for a standard diesel engine.
Where can batteries be charged up?
At any accessible power point
How long do the batteries take to charge?
That depends on the power point “size”. Using 400 volt/32 ampere it takes about four hours. With a 230 volt/16 ampere point, about 28 hours.
What do I do if the batteries run out when I’m at sea?
There will be a power gauge that provides information in the same way as a fuel gauge. However, if you do run out of power you can start up the little fuel-powered generator and drive home slowly.
Where can batteries be charged?
From any power point. For a fast charge you need a standard 3-phase, 32 A power point.
How long is the working life of the batteries?
It’s a little early to say, but probably at least 5000 charges – a good many years of use in other words – around 10-15 years.
What does a new battery cost?
Using the Electroengines TEBS™ system, separate cell modules can be replaced if necessary for 100 – 200 euro.

Does the electrically powered boat generate any emissions at all?
No, not while driven under electric power. However, we plan to complement the power source with a fuel-driven generator that can be used in emergencies, both for charging and for driving the boat. This small generator will run at optimum rpm for a minimum amount of emission.
